什么是MySQL用戶組?
MySQL用戶組是指一組具有共同數據庫訪問權限的人員。在Linux系統中,為了更好地管理MySQL數據庫,我們需要創(chuàng)建和管理MySQL用戶組。這些用戶組允許特定的用戶訪問特定的數據庫,同時還允許對數據庫進行不同級別的操作權限控制。
如何添加MySQL用戶組?
要在Linux系統中添加MySQL用戶組,我們需要使用以下步驟:
- 通過SSH遠程連接到Linux服務器
- 使用root用戶登錄系統
- 運行以下命令以創(chuàng)建MySQL用戶組:
sudo groupadd mysql
- 運行以下命令以將用戶添加到MySQL用戶組:
sudo usermod -a -G mysql username
如何為MySQL用戶組授權?
在Linux系統中,我們可以為MySQL用戶組授予不同級別的權限,以便在數據庫訪問控制方面更好地管理。要為MySQL用戶組授權,請按照以下步驟操作:
- 使用SSH遠程連接到Linux服務器
- 使用root用戶登錄系統,使用以下命令登錄到MySQL服務器:
mysql -u root -p
- 輸入MySQL管理員密碼,然后創(chuàng)建新的MySQL用戶并為其分配權限,例如:
GRANT ALL PRIVILEGES ON *.* TO 'newuser'@'localhost' IDENTIFIED BY 'password';
- 最后,使用FLUSH PRIVILEGES命令以確保MySQL服務器讀取新的授權表:
FLUSH PRIVILEGES;
總結
在Linux系統中,為了充分發(fā)揮MySQL數據庫的功能,我們需要創(chuàng)建和管理MySQL用戶組。添加和授權MySQL用戶組的過程需要一定的技巧和注意事項,但一旦設置成功,它將允許我們更好地管理和控制數據庫的訪問權限,提高我們的工作效率和安全性。